About Camp Hill:
Once settled in the 1870s, Camp Hill has blossomed into one of Brisbane's most desirable inner-east suburbs. With its blend of character homes, leafy outlooks, and a friendly village vibe, it appeals to both established families and savvy professionals.
Local favourites include funky cafes, a charming French wine bar, bush walks, Brisbane's best kids' playground, and a celebrated antique centre. The mix of Queenslanders, art deco gems, postwar charmers and new builds gives Camp Hill a unique and eclectic feel.
